Origin and history
The Hôtel de Gride is a historic monument located in Arles, in the Bouches-du-Rhône department, in the Provence-Alpes-Côte d'Azur region. This building, whose exact address is 12 Bis Rue de Gride, has been listed as Historic Monuments since 1946. The protected elements include the facades on terrace and street, the roof, the terrace itself and the interior staircase, according to the decree of 31 May 1946.
